I use POSKY 767-300also I use the panel and the ***.air file from the PIC for this airplane.I could not fly this aircraft with the PIC panel unless I used their ***.air file which is fine it works great, just so you know that you won't be able to fly POSKY 767 with PIC panel without also using PIC ***.air file. Well I could not anyways, the aircraft would fail to climb as soon FLT180+ and there was no cure for it untill I came up with the idea of also using their ***.air file.You can also look for merger files that someone else sugested they might even be a better choice then mine, but I do not know of any.. never looked for them.. so can't help you there...Also as I did it the panel works with aircraft well, IE engine on fire, all mulfunctions etc.. start up prosedure it works all well.Andy

Guest WorkingStiff

No, it's more than just replacing textures...you'd also have to edit the airline configuration file and make other adjustmentsHowever, as previous posters mentioned; there are merge files already created that will correctly combine the POSKY aircraft with the 767 PIC panel.If you go to the 767 PIC forum, you would see frequent mention of these merge files. Search for "Lee Hetheringtion" in the PIC forum and you'll find the link to download these merge files.
